2004 Chevrolet Venture vs. 2009 Chevrolet Aveo

To start off, 2009 Chevrolet Aveo is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 Chevrolet Venture.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 Chevrolet Venture would be higher. At 3,392 cc (6 cylinders), 2004 Chevrolet Venture is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Chevrolet Venture (185 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 80 more horse power than 2009 Chevrolet Aveo. (105 HP @ 6400 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 Chevrolet Venture should accelerate faster than 2009 Chevrolet Aveo.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Chevrolet Venture (286 Nm) has 180 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Chevrolet Aveo. (106 Nm). This means 2004 Chevrolet Venture will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Chevrolet Aveo.

Compare all specifications:

2004 Chevrolet Venture 2009 Chevrolet Aveo
Make Chevrolet Chevrolet
Model Venture Aveo
Year Released 2004 2009
Body Type Minivan Sedan
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3392 cc 1599 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 185 HP 105 HP
Engine RPM 5600 RPM 6400 RPM
Torque 286 Nm 106 Nm
Drive Type Front Front
Number of Seats 7 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Length 5110 mm 3930 mm
Vehicle Width 1840 mm 1720 mm
Vehicle Height 1740 mm 1510 mm
Wheelbase Size 3050 mm 2490 mm
Fuel Consumption Highway 9.8 L/100km 6.9 L/100km
Fuel Consumption City 13.1 L/100km 8.7 L/100km
Fuel Tank Capacity 95 L 35 L
